By now, chances are you’ve heard of the rumors swirling about that Rockstar’s Grand Theft Auto V has since been leaked online by nefarious individuals.

Just earlier today, we even posted what seems to be a legit loading screen and intro from the actual game.

Sadly, Rockstar has just confirmed the leak as being legit. Over on their official site, Rockstar made an announcement that GTA V has gone “gold,” which is a term used when the game itself is done with development and is ready to be pressed and shipped to retailers.

In the same post, Rockstar also acknowledges that GTA V has indeed been leaked and from Sony’s EU PlayStation Store no less.

Here’s Sony Social Media Manager Sid Shuman had to say in its entirety:

Regrettably, some people who downloaded the digital pre-order of Grand Theft Auto V through the PlayStation Store in Europe were able to access certain GTA V assets. These assets were posted online. We have since removed the digital pre-order file from the PlayStation Store in Europe. We sincerely apologize to Rockstar and GTA fans across the world who were exposed to the spoiler content. GTA V is one of the most highly anticipated games of the year with a very passionate following, and we’re looking forward to a historic launch on September 17.

Rockstar adds that they’re “deeply disappointed by leaks and spoilers being spread in advance of the game’s launch. GTAV represents years of hard work by many people across the world, and we all couldn’t be more excited to finally share it with you properly this September 17th.”

So, just a word of warning for GTA fans, stay out of forums, messageboards and other social outlets you don’t trust as I’m sure there are more than a few people willing to spoil GTA V’s story and then some.
